Roof repair costs depend on several specific factors. The size of the damaged area is the biggest variable, along with the accessibility of your roof and the pitch or steepness involved. We also look at the underlying materials—like whether you have standard asphalt shingles, metal, or tile—and the complexity of the flashing around chimneys or vents. Corrugated metal roofing features panels with a wavy, ridged design that provides excellent structural strength and water runoff capabilities. This style is often chosen for its long lifespan and ability to stand up to heavy snow or wind. If your panels are rusting, loose, or dented, repair or replacement may be necessary to maintain your home’s integrity. The final price is typically driven by the panel gauge and total roof area. For roofing applications, licensed pros often use high-quality silicone or acrylic-based sealants. These are chosen for their flexibility and resistance to UV rays and temperature changes. They create a durable, waterproof barrier around seams, fasteners, and penetrations. Proper application by experienced professionals is crucial for effectiveness.

A galvanized steel roof is made from steel that has been coated with zinc. This zinc coating provides a protective layer against rust and corrosion, significantly increasing the material's lifespan and durability. It's a popular choice for metal roofing due to its resistance to the elements and long-term value.
